The Weekly Bottom Line: Until the Job Is Done
U.S. Highlights The Federal Reserve hiked the fed funds rate 25 basis-points, a step down from six consecutive hikes of 50 or 75 bps. Non-farm payrolls accelerated in January for the first time in five months, adding 517k jobs and nearly tripling market expectations. Market Dynamics Change at the Wake of the Monstrous NFP Beat
US NFP printed 517’000 last Friday. More than half a million. It’s a monstrous gap with the 185’000 expected by analysts. And even if the seasonal factors may have affected the January report… 517’000 jobs, is quite a STRONG number for a monthly NFP report. The unemployment rate unexpectedly fell to 3.4%. Stocks and Bonds Down, Dollar Up
Markets Friday was all about exceptionally strong US payrolls and a sharp rebound in the services ISM. The former showed a 517k job creation in January with details strong across the board.
